Pros and Cons of Living in Zambia

By Joshua Wood, LPC

Last updated on Jan 04, 2024

Summary: The pros of living in Zambia include its diverse culture, beautiful landscapes, and friendly people. Zambia is also home to many national parks and wildlife reserves, making it a great destination for nature lovers. Additionally, the cost of living in Zambia is relatively low, making it an attractive option for those looking to stretch their budget. The cons of living in Zambia include the lack of infrastructure and access to basic services such as healthcare and education. Additionally, the country is prone to natural disasters such as floods and droughts, which can cause significant disruption to daily life. The political situation in Zambia is also unstable, with frequent changes in government and a lack of economic stability.

What are the pros and cons of living in Zambia?

Expats, digital nomads and retirees living in Zambia responded:

"Expats and digital nomads in Zambia appreciate the country's natural beauty, with its lush forests, rolling hills, and stunning waterfalls. They also enjoy the friendly and welcoming people, who are always willing to help out newcomers. Additionally, the cost of living is relatively low, making it an attractive destination for those looking to stretch their budget. On the downside, the infrastructure in Zambia is not as developed as in other countries, making it difficult to access certain services and amenities. Additionally, the country is prone to power outages, which can be a major inconvenience," said one expat in living in Zambia.
